In an effort to alleviate the burden Allegheny County property owners have faced with the Court-ordered reassessment, Senator Fontana has drafted legislation that enables the County to move away from an archaic and inequitable system and eliminate property reassessments, replacing them with a fairer system.
Senator Fontana has re-introduced legislation that would require large non-profits to pay real estate taxes based on the value of their land only. The first $200,000 of total land value is exempt to protect the small non-profits. The legislation seeks to fix the current imbalance created by large non-profits buying large parcels of valuable land and not paying property taxes, with individual homeowners bearing the burden.
